UN chief ready to work closely with next US administration
04/11/2008
UN chief Ban Ki-moon says he's ready and prepared to work very closely with the next President of the United States.
Responding to reporters' questions Monday, Mr. Ban said he wil e able to strengthen the partnership between the United Nations and the next administration in the United States."Since I became Secretary-General, one of my focuses, or priorities, has been to maintain a very strong and close partnership between the United States and the United Nations, because I believe, personally and officially, that maintaining such a good relationship with the host government, and the largest financial contributor, and one of the biggest world leaders, is very important."
The Secretary-General said in fact, with the Bush administration, he's been able to improve the working relationship to a very positive tone.
